Make djui run at 60fps in the pause menu again

This commit is contained in:
MysterD 2022-04-29 21:59:09 -07:00
parent 2745fb3383
commit 3dab069f87
2 changed files with 2 additions and 2 deletions

View File

@ -25,7 +25,7 @@ void patch_djui_before(void) {
void patch_djui_interpolated(UNUSED f32 delta) { void patch_djui_interpolated(UNUSED f32 delta) {
// reset the head and re-render DJUI // reset the head and re-render DJUI
if (delta >= 0.5f && !sDjuiRendered60fps && gDjuiInMainMenu) { if (delta >= 0.5f && !sDjuiRendered60fps && (gDjuiInMainMenu || gDjuiPanelPauseCreated)) {
sDjuiRendered60fps = true; sDjuiRendered60fps = true;
if (sSavedDisplayListHead == NULL) { return; } if (sSavedDisplayListHead == NULL) { return; }
gDisplayListHead = sSavedDisplayListHead; gDisplayListHead = sSavedDisplayListHead;

View File

@ -597,7 +597,7 @@ static struct LuaObjectField sGraphNodeObjectFields[LUA_GRAPH_NODE_OBJECT_FIELD_
{ "sharedChild", LVT_COBJECT_P, offsetof(struct GraphNodeObject, sharedChild), false, LOT_GRAPHNODE }, { "sharedChild", LVT_COBJECT_P, offsetof(struct GraphNodeObject, sharedChild), false, LOT_GRAPHNODE },
{ "skipInterpolationTimestamp", LVT_U32, offsetof(struct GraphNodeObject, skipInterpolationTimestamp), false, LOT_NONE }, { "skipInterpolationTimestamp", LVT_U32, offsetof(struct GraphNodeObject, skipInterpolationTimestamp), false, LOT_NONE },
// { "throwMatrix", LVT_???, offsetof(struct GraphNodeObject, throwMatrix), false, LOT_??? }, <--- UNIMPLEMENTED // { "throwMatrix", LVT_???, offsetof(struct GraphNodeObject, throwMatrix), false, LOT_??? }, <--- UNIMPLEMENTED
// { "throwMatrixPrev", LVT_???, offsetof(struct GraphNodeObject, throwMatrixPrev), false, LOT_??? }, <--- UNIMPLEMENTED // { "throwMatrixPrev", LVT_???, offsetof(struct GraphNodeObject, throwMatrixPrev), false, LOT_??? }, <--- UNIMPLEMENTED
{ "unk4C", LVT_COBJECT_P, offsetof(struct GraphNodeObject, unk4C), false, LOT_SPAWNINFO }, { "unk4C", LVT_COBJECT_P, offsetof(struct GraphNodeObject, unk4C), false, LOT_SPAWNINFO },
}; };